Hello, I have seen Bridelia berries at all stages and have eaten them too. They are quite sweet when ripe. I am confident that the tree in picture is not Bridelia. It neither seems to be Lagerstroemia as the leaves donot seem to be opposite.
I may be incorrect about Lagerstroemia.
